About Disability Law in Anamnagar, Nepal:

Disability law in Anamnagar, Nepal aims to protect the rights and promote the inclusion of individuals with disabilities. It covers a wide range of issues such as accessibility, discrimination, education, employment, and social services.

Local Laws Overview:

Local laws in Anamnagar, Nepal prohibit discrimination against individuals with disabilities in various settings, including employment, education, and public accommodations. The government also provides support services and benefits to individuals with disabilities to ensure their full participation in society.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What are the rights of individuals with disabilities in Anamnagar, Nepal?

Individuals with disabilities in Anamnagar, Nepal have the right to equal opportunities, reasonable accommodations, and protection from discrimination. They are also entitled to social services and benefits to help them live independently.

2. How can I apply for disability benefits in Anamnagar, Nepal?

You can apply for disability benefits through the Social Welfare Council of Nepal. They will assess your eligibility and provide you with the necessary support and services.

3. Can I be discriminated against in the workplace because of my disability?

No, discrimination based on disability is prohibited in the workplace in Anamnagar, Nepal. Employers are required to provide reasonable accommodations to employees with disabilities to ensure equal opportunities for all.

4. What should I do if my disability benefits application is denied?

If your disability benefits application is denied, you have the right to appeal the decision. You can seek legal assistance to help you navigate the appeals process and advocate for your rights.

5. Are there any organizations in Anamnagar, Nepal that provide support for individuals with disabilities?

Yes, there are several organizations in Anamnagar, Nepal that provide support services, advocacy, and resources for individuals with disabilities. Some of these organizations include the National Federation of the Disabled Nepal and the Nepal Disabled Women Association.

6. Do I need a lawyer to file a disability discrimination complaint?

While you are not required to have a lawyer to file a disability discrimination complaint, having legal representation can help ensure that your rights are protected and that you have the best possible outcome in your case.

7. How can I access accessible transportation in Anamnagar, Nepal?

The government of Nepal has implemented accessible transportation services for individuals with disabilities. You can contact the Department of Transport Management for more information on accessible transportation options in Anamnagar.

8. Are there programs in Anamnagar, Nepal that support the education of individuals with disabilities?

Yes, there are programs in Anamnagar, Nepal that support inclusive education for individuals with disabilities. The government has implemented policies to ensure that individuals with disabilities have access to quality education and support services.

9. Can I be evicted from my home because of my disability?

No, individuals with disabilities are protected from eviction based on their disability in Anamnagar, Nepal. Landlords are required to provide reasonable accommodations to tenants with disabilities.

10. What legal resources are available for individuals with disabilities in Anamnagar, Nepal?

Individuals with disabilities in Anamnagar, Nepal can access legal resources through government agencies, legal aid organizations, and disability rights advocates. These resources can provide information, advice, and support for individuals seeking legal assistance.
